Abstract

The utility model discloses the plastics recovery grinding devices for environmental protection, including the first cabinet, first cabinet is provided with first motor on the left of rear portion, the first rotary shaft is fixedly connected on front side of the first motor output shaft, the front side of first rotary shaft is through the first cabinet and is arranged with active crushing wheel, and first cabinet is provided with the second motor on the right side of rear portion.The utility model passes through the first cabinet, first motor, the first rotary shaft, active crushing wheel, the second motor, the second rotary shaft, driven crushing wheel, the second cabinet, third motor, agitating shaft, bearing block, the cooperation for crushing gear piece, driving wheel, belt, driven wheel, crank throw, second bearing seat, movable sleeve, motion bar, fixing seat, sieve and fixed block, plastic product can sufficiently be crushed, it solves the problems, such as that conventional size reduction device crushing effect is poor, avoids the recycling enhancing labor intensity for crushing insufficient plastics to user.

Plastics recovery grinding device for environmental protection
Technical field
The utility model relates to technical field of plastic, particularly for the plastics recovery grinding device of environmental protection.
Background technique
Plastics are, by high-molecular compound made of addition polymerization or polycondensation polymerized, to be commonly called as plastics using monomer as raw material Or resin, it can freely change ingredient and body styles, by synthetic resin and filler, plasticizer, stabilizer, lubricant, colorant Equal additives composition.
As rate of industrial development is getting faster, various plastic products are produced according to people's lives demand, so And after the completion of plastic product use, it is polluted the environment due to plastics non-degradable, while easily, thus user's needs pair It is recycled using the plastic product of completion, when user is recycled plastics, needs to use grinding device, however Traditional grinding device crushing effect is poor, and sufficiently screening cannot be carried out to plastic product and is crushed, and needs user to not crushing Plastic product carries out multiple crushing and processing, enhances the labor intensity of user, reduces the working efficiency of user.

In use, opening first motor 2, the second motor 5, third motor 9 and solenoid valve 26 by peripheral control unit, use The plastic product of recycling is added in the first cabinet 1 person from loading hopper 23, is opposite fortune by first motor 2 and the second motor 5 Dynamic, the crushing effect of reinforced plastics product, first motor 2 and the second motor 5 drive the first rotary shaft 3 and the second rotary shaft respectively 6 are relatively rotated, and by the cooperation of securing plate, are enhanced the stability of first motor 2 and the second motor 5, are passed through first motor 2 It is relative motion, the crushing effect of reinforced plastics product, thus the first rotary shaft 3 and the second rotary shaft 6 difference with the second motor 5 It drives active crushing wheel 4 and driven crushing wheel 7 to be relatively rotated, is engaged by active crushing wheel 4 and driven crushing wheel 7, from And first time crushing can be carried out to plastic product, solenoid valve 26 controls baffle 27 and is moved downward, smashed plastic product It falls in the second cabinet 8, by the cooperation of first bearing seat 11, so that third motor 9 drives agitating shaft 10, driving wheel respectively 13 are rotated with gear piece 12 is crushed, and the plastic product of crushing can be crushed by crushing gear piece 12, and driving wheel 13 passes through belt 14 drive driven wheels 15 are rotated, and by the cooperation of second bearing seat 11, driven wheel 15 drives crank throw 16 to be rotated, crank throw 16 drive movable sleeves 18 are rotated, by the cooperation of movable axis, thus movable sleeve 18 drive motion bar 19 and fixing seat 20 into Row moves up and down, by the cooperation of fixed block 22 and movable axis, so that fixing seat 20 drives sieve 21 to move up and down, particle Small plastics are discharged outside the second cabinet 8 from the second discharge bucket 29, by the cooperation of inclined plate, avoid plastics in 8 corner of the second cabinet It accumulates, the big plastics of particle are retained in 21 surface of sieve, and by the cooperation of hinge, chamber door 28 and handle, user's particle is big Crushing plastics are taken out to be crushed again.
